What is insomnia?

Insomnia is a common sleep disorder characterized by difficulty falling asleep, staying asleep, or waking up too early and not being able to get back to sleep. People with insomnia often feel tired during the day, which can affect their mood, energy levels, and overall quality of life. Insomnia can be caused by stress, medical conditions, medications, or unhealthy sleep habits, and it can be short-term (acute) or long-term (chronic). Treatment options include improving sleep hygiene, cognitive behavioral therapy, and sometimes medication.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an insomnia specialist?

To thrive as an Insomnia Specialist, you need expertise in sleep medicine, a medical degree or psychology background, and specific training or certification in sleep disorders. Familiarity with polysomnography, actigraphy, and cognitive behavioral therapy for insomnia (CBT-I) is typically required. Strong interpersonal, analytical, and patient education skills help build trust and ensure effective treatment plans. These competencies are crucial for accurately diagnosing sleep disorders and guiding patients toward improved health and quality of life.

What are some common challenges insomnia therapists face when supporting clients with chronic sleep issues?

Insomnia Therapists often encounter challenges such as helping clients break long-standing habits that negatively impact sleep and addressing underlying factors like anxiety or lifestyle stressors. Building trust and maintaining client engagement over multiple sessions can also be difficult, especially when progress is gradual. Therapists regularly collaborate with primary care physicians, psychologists, and sometimes sleep specialists to create comprehensive treatment plans tailored to each client’s needs.
